#e00ee4 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#e00ee4 is composed of 87.8% red, 5.5% green and 89.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 1.8% cyan, 93.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 10.6% black. It has a hue angle of 298.9 degrees, a saturation of 88.4% and a lightness of 47.5%. #e00ee4 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ff1cff with #c100c9. Closest websafe color is: #cc00cc.

#e00ee4 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#e00ee4 has RGB values of R:224, G:14, B:228 and CMYK values of C:0.02, M:0.94, Y:0,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 14683876.

Shades and Tints of #e00ee4

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060006 is the darkest color, while #fef3f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#e00ee4

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7d747e is the less saturated color, while #e905ed is the most saturated one.
